When most people think of breast cancer, they imagine it as a disease that only affects women. However, men too are at risk, and their awareness about this fact is crucial for timely diagnosis, effective breast cancer treatment, and improved survival outcomes. As someone with over 26 years of experience in surgical oncology, I have seen firsthand how a lack of awareness can delay lifesaving interventions for men.
Understanding Breast Cancer in Men
Breast cancer develops in the breast tissue, which is present in both men and women, though men have much less of it. Despite its rarity (less than 1% of all breast cancers occur in men), ignoring the possibility can have serious consequences. Age is a significant risk factor, but genetics, family history, hormone imbalance, and underlying health conditions also play a role.

Typical Symptoms to Watch For
Men may not recognise early warning signs since most do not expect to get this disease. Common symptoms include:
- A painless lump or thickening in the chest area (behind or near the nipple)
- Changes in skin texture or colour around the nipple, such as redness or scaling
- Inverted nipple or discharge, sometimes bloody
If you experience any of these symptoms, consult a qualified oncologist without delay.

Why Awareness Is Critical
Men often ignore symptoms until the cancer has progressed to an advanced stage. Awareness matters because:
- Early detection saves lives. When treated early, breast cancer is highly curable.
- Being informed leads to faster diagnosis, fewer complications, and improved quality of life.
- Spreading awareness helps reduce stigma and encourages men to seek help without embarrassment.

Steps Men Can Take
- Be aware of your family history regarding breast and other cancers.
- Lead a healthy lifestyle and get regular medical check-ups.
- Don’t ignore changes in your chest or nipple area.
- Consult a surgical oncologist specialist at the earliest sign of symptoms.
